Title: Repatriated prisoner of war is processed
Maker: Bowen, Stella
Object type: Painting
Place made: United Kingdom: England, Greater London, London
Date made: 1945
Physical description: oil on canvas
Measurements: 76.6 x 91.4 cm
Summary: Two central soldier figures, possibly a portrait of Alexander Paton. The soldier facing away from the viewer represents the soldier at war, while the hatless soldier facing the viewer, with arms folded, is about to be repatriated. In the background the artist focuses on six pairs of hands engaged in activities representing each stage of the repatriated soldier's processing, including medical and dental checks, first aid kits etc.
